Oracle and Bloom Energy Collaborate to Deliver Power to Data Centers at the Speed of AI

1. Bloom Energy secures deployment contract with Oracle Cloud Infrastructure for fuel cells. 2. The deal supports increased demand for OCI's AI and cloud services.
